Growth of the Global Electrical Bushing Market
The global electrical bushing market is poised for significant growth, with projections indicating an increase from USD 2.69 billion in 2023 to USD 4.05 billion by 2033. This represents a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 4.18% throughout the forecast period. Understanding Electrical Bushings
Electrical bushings are essential components found in high-voltage electrical equipment, such as power transformers, shunt reactors, circuit breakers, and capacitors. They enable the transfer of electrical current from high-voltage systems to lower-voltage environments. By minimizing energy losses and reducing the risk of electrical arcs, they play a vital role in maintaining system efficiency.
Key Drivers for Market Growth
The expanding global electrical bushing market is primarily fueled by several key factors. One of the most significant drivers is the rise in renewable energy initiatives. As countries work to boost their renewable energy production, the demand for efficient electrical bushings is expected to increase. Additionally, investments aimed at modernizing and expanding electrical grids are contributing to the market's growth.
Moreover, rapid urbanization and industrialization are creating a higher demand for electric infrastructure, further supporting the electrical bushing market. However, challenges such as high acquisition costs, the need for skilled labor, environmental concerns, and stringent regulatory frameworks could hinder market progress.
Market Segmentation and Insights
Segmentation within the electrical bushing market helps to pinpoint both opportunities and challenges across various categories. The market can be divided based on type, application, insulation materials, and end-users.
Types of Electrical Bushings
When classified by type, the market comprises oil-impregnated paper (OIP), resin-impregnated paper (RIP), and other varieties. The oil-impregnated paper segment is anticipated to take the lead due to its superior electrical performance and enhanced dielectric strength. OIP bushings effectively manage leakage current and prevent external flashovers, making them a favored choice.
Application Segmentation
In terms of application, the market is divided into medium voltage (MV), high voltage (HV), and extra high voltage (EHV) categories. The MV segment is expected to capture a significant market share, largely due to the widespread use of MV bushings in substations and industrial environments where voltages range from 1 kV to 36 kV.
Trends in Insulation and Material Usage
Another noteworthy trend in the electrical bushing market is the growing adoption of polymeric insulation. This segment is projected to exhibit the fastest growth, thanks to its mechanical strength and thermal stability. Polymeric bushings are also lighter, simplifying installation, and they provide enhanced resistance to pollution and environmental factors.
End-User Dynamics
The utilities sector is expected to dominate the electrical bushing market, as utility companies require dependable high-performance bushings for transformers and switchgear. These bushings are essential for ensuring efficient power distribution to residential, commercial, and industrial consumers.
Regional Market Insights
The Asia Pacific region is anticipated to hold the largest market share, driven by the presence of leading manufacturers and rapidly developing infrastructure. Additionally, it benefits from a favorable labor cost and a strong supply chain.
In contrast, the Middle East and Africa are projected to experience the fastest growth in the electrical bushing market. Investments in renewable energy projects, particularly in solar and wind generation, are expected to boost demand for advanced electrical equipment, including bushings.
